MEDIA RELEASE: QIA extends condolences on passing of our Igloolik Board Member, Johnny Malaiya Kublu
Iqaluit, Nunavut – May 4, 2020 – The Qikiqtani Inuit Association (QIA) is saddened to announce the passing of our Igloolik Board Member, Johnny Malaiya Kublu. QIA extends condolences to his family, friends and community members.
“Johnny Malaiya Kublu was a kind, humble and well-respected community leader,” says QIA President, P.J. Akeeagok, “he had a passion for our culture and worked hard to record and preserve the knowledge of Inuit Elders. He will be greatly missed.”
Johnny Malaiya Kublu was born in Nunasiaq, near Pond Inlet and raised in Igloolik. He was serving his second term as QIA’s Community Director for Igloolik. He was first elected in 2014. During his time with the Board, he served as a member of the QIA Finance Committee. Kublu was also a Government Liaison Officer with the Government of Nunavut.
One of Kublu’s passions was his work recording Elders’ knowledge, a record which is now resource material for the Piqqusilirivvik cultural school in Clyde River.
Johnny Malaiya Kublu is survived by his wife, Veronica Aqiaruq Kublu, his eight children and many grandchildren.
